The sensors in the Independent Living system are designed for long operation without maintenance.
Typical battery life is approximately:
2 years for motion sensors
7 years for door sensors (magnet contacts)
The battery in the motion sensors have a shorter lifetime because they are active throughout the day while monitoring movement. This continuous operation ensures reliable activity detection but uses more power than traditional alarm sensors, which are only active when armed.
When a battery becomes low, the system will send an automatic notification so it can be replaced.
